Overview Ator-UP 10 Tablet
Lipitor-Equiv 10mg tablets are statin medications used to lower cholesterol and mitigate cardiovascular disease risk. High cholesterol, a fatty substance accumulating in blood vessels, causes narrowing that can lead to strokes or heart attacks. Widely prescribed and generally safe for long-term use under medical supervision, this medication can be taken with or without food, consistently at the same time daily. High cholesterol often presents without symptoms; discontinuing treatment elevates cholesterol and increases stroke/heart attack risk. Regular cholesterol monitoring is crucial. Treatment involves lifestyle changes including balanced nutrition, regular physical activity, smoking cessation, moderate alcohol consumption, and weight management. While maintaining a typical diet, limiting high-fat foods is advisable. Common, typically mild and transient, side effects are constipation, gas, indigestion, and abdominal discomfort. Persistent side effects, jaundice, or recurring unexplained muscle pain warrant immediate medical attention. Contraindicated in liver disease, pregnancy, and breastfeeding (due to potential harm to the developing fetus), this medication may elevate blood sugar levels in diabetics, requiring blood glucose monitoring. Liver function tests may be performed before and during treatment.

How Ator-UP 10 Tablet works:
Atorvastatin 10 mg tablets reduce elevated cholesterol levels. This statin medication inhibits HMG-CoA reductase, an enzyme crucial for cholesterol synthesis. Consequently, it decreases LDL cholesterol ("bad" cholesterol) and triglycerides, while increasing HDL cholesterol ("good" cholesterol).
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Exercise caution when combining Ator-UP 10 Tablet and alcohol. Physician consultation is recommended.
PregnancyUNSAFE
Use of Ator-UP 10 Tablet is strongly contraindicated during pregnancy. Pregnant women should consult their physician, as research in animal and human studies reveals substantial risks to the fetus.
Breast feedingUNSAFE
Lactation and Ator-UP 10 Tablet are incompatible; evidence indicates potential infant harm from this medication.
DrivingSAFE
Driving ability is typically unaffected by Ator-UP 10 Tablet.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Ator-UP 10 Tablets pose no safety concerns for individuals with kidney conditions; dosage modification is unnecessary. Nevertheless, disclosure of any pre-existing kidney disease to your physician is advisable.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Ator-UP 10 Tablet c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. Ator-UP 10 Tablet is contraindicated for individuals with severe or active liver disease.
What if you forget to take Ator-UP 10 Tablet :
Should you forget a dose of Ator-UP 10 Tablet,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king two doses in a 12-hour period.
